# Moving Signed Contracts Between Offices

Signed contracts travelling from the Westerholt office to the Fennmarsh receiving site must be double-enveloped, sealed with a numbered tab, and logged in the transit register before release. Only drivers from Garrow Secure Transit may carry them. On arrival, the receiving clerk verifies the seal, then gives the courier this instruction:

dispatch memo: the lamwyn fenwyn courier leaves the wenir ledger at gate 7175 under passcode 822969

Onboarding note for the Ledgerpane admin table: bulk edits are applied through the batcher service, not directly against the database. Select rows, choose an action, and the batcher stages changes in a pending set you can review before commit. Edits over 500 rows require a second approver — this is enforced server-side, so don't try to chunk around it. To run the batcher locally you need the staging write credential, which goes in your .env as the next line.

secret setting of bahip-kagag: RELAY_SECRET3=c83

Ticket #—facilities, night shift. Landlord (Ostermane Property Group) audits the Calloway Street site Thursday 06:00, before dayside arrives. Clear the loading corridor, confirm fire doors close fully, and check emergency lighting on floors 1–3. Auditor arrives with our site manager, Petra Lindqvist; no escort needed beyond reception. Their access is limited to common areas. To admit them through the service entrance, use the following.

door code, bagef-yafop: bdg-ZFZML-07646

## v2.8.0 — Payroll Export Change

Heads up, newcomers: PayRollo now exports payroll runs as tab-delimited files instead of the old fixed-width format. Downstream imports into LedgerNest were updated last sprint, so nothing should break. If you maintain any custom scripts, swap your parsers before the next pay cycle. Questions about the migration go to the person below.

account owner for bawip-tahag: Raleth Quenok